Sales in the quarter were lower year-on-year, but at an expected level and with healthy profitability
Net sales for the quarter amounted to SEK 2,226m (3,034), corresponding to a decrease of 26.6 percent. Adjusted for exchange rate fluctuations, sales declined 31.4 percent. Operating income amounted to SEK 382m (692), corresponding to a margin of 17.2 percent (22.8). Adjusted for exchange rate fluctuations, the operating margin decreased 5.5 percentage points. Fourth Quarter Net sales for the quarter amounted to SEK 1,651m (1,846), corresponding to a decrease of 10.6 percent. Adjusted for exchange rate fluctuations, sales declined 21.0 percent. Operating income amounted to SEK 4m (190), corresponding to a margin of 0.2 percent (10.3). Adjusted for exchange rate fluctuations, the operating margin decreased 11.5 percentage points. …

Thule Group’s board of directors has today decided to appoint Mattias Ankarberg as the new president and CEO of the company. To secure a seamless handover, Magnus Welander will remain in his role until Mattias Ankarberg has finished his current role.
